ABSTRACT DEVELOPMENT OF THE ATTITUDE SCALE TOWARDS WOMEN MANAGERS IN HEALTH INSTITUTIONS: VALIDITY AND RELIABILITY STUDY In the study, it was aimed to develop the scale of attitudes towards female managers in health institutions. The sample of the study consists of 352 health personnel working in Bursa City Hospital. The data were collected with the "Personal Information Form" and the "Draft Attitude Scale Towards Women Managers in Health Institutions". Expert opinions were taken for the scope validity of the scale draft and the scope validity index was determined as 0.77. As a result of the evaluation of the data, it was found that the total score correlation values of the scale item were between -0.193 and 0.804;The KMO value was 0.942 and the Bartlett test results were statistically significant. According to the factor analysis, it was found that the item factor loads were between 0.417 and 0.804, the scale consisted of 29 items and 2 sub-dimensions, and the goodness of fit values were within acceptable limits (χ2= 587.858 (sd)= 316; p< 0.001; χ2 /sd= 1.860; CFI= 0.905; IFI= 0.907; RMSEA= 0.083; SRMR= 0.0525).According to the item discrimination analysis, it was determined that the mean scores of 27% lower and upper quarters showed a statistically significant difference between the two sub-dimensions. Regarding the reliability of the scale, the Cronbach alpha value was 0.957, the Spearman-Brown value was 0.748-0.974 with the halving technique; The Guttman Split-Half value was found to be between 0.748-0.973. In the test-retest analysis, it was determined that there was no statistically significant difference between the mean scores of the first and last tests in the sub-dimensions of positive attitudes and negative attitudes (p>0.05).As a result, it has been seen that the scale developed to measure the attitude towards female managers in health institutions is a valid and reliable measurement tool as a result of the analyzes.
